A low light plant list optimized for bedrooms is not the same list as a general low light plant list, because a bedroom is not the same room as a living room. Bedrooms typically get less natural light than other rooms (closed doors, drawn curtains, sleep-mask darkness that adds another four to six hours of night), run drier in winter because heating vents push warm air through the space, and carry safety constraints (pets sleep here, kids might, and the plant on the nightstand cannot become a trip hazard at 2 a.m.). Low light houseplants for the bedroom need to clear all three filters — shade tolerance, dry-air tolerance, and placement safety — before they earn the slot.

What Makes a Bedroom Different From Other Low-Light Rooms
Bedrooms are not just dimmer than other rooms; they are dimmer on a specific pattern that excludes some species and protects others. Three constraints stack against most houseplants in this room.

Hours of usable light run shorter than the same window in a living room. A north-facing or west-facing bedroom — and most are one or the other, because builders put the master on the quieter side of the lot — gets roughly 8 to 10 hours of usable light across a day, but 6 to 8 of those are below 50 foot-candles (too dim for most species to drive meaningful photosynthesis). That puts a bedroom 1.5 to 2x below the light integral of an equivalent-sized living room with the same exposure. The low light plants guide covers the foot-candle scale in detail; the practical takeaway is that a bedroom plant needs a lower light compensation point than a living-room plant — the threshold where photosynthesis breaks even with respiration — and that excludes most flowering species outright.
Humidity in winter drops below what humidity-loving plants tolerate. Bedrooms are usually closed-door spaces for 8 to 10 hours overnight, and forced-air heating systems push dry air through the room. Indoor humidity in a winter bedroom typically lands at 25 to 35% — well below the 50 to 60% threshold that Calathea, Boston Fern, and most tropical foliage species need to hold their leaves. The honest limitation: a Calathea that thrives in a 55% humidity greenhouse will drop leaves within four to six weeks in a 30% winter bedroom. That is why Calathea ranks low on this bedroom list despite being a strong shade-tolerant plant in other rooms.
Safety constraints are real and they change which mature sizes make the cut. A 36-inch floor plant next to a bed is a fall hazard when the reader reaches for a phone at 2 a.m. (the failure mode — bent stems, spilled soil, broken pot, plant on the floor). A tall narrow plant on a wobbly nightstand is the same hazard at smaller scale. Bedrooms need plants with stable, low centers of gravity OR plants on dressers and stands that are tall enough not to be tripped over. That is why the picks list below separates nightstand-size (under 14 inches mature), dresser-size (14 to 28 inches), and floor-size (over 28 inches) — each tier has its own safety profile.
The Air Quality and Sleep Claims: What’s Real and What’s Hype
The bedroom is where the wellness industry makes the most expansive claims about houseplants, and most of those claims do not survive contact with evidence. The split is clean: biophilic stress reduction is real (modest, replicated). Air purification is mostly marketing.
| Claim | Evidence strength | Honest take |
|---|---|---|
| Plants reduce perceived stress and improve sleep quality | Moderate — replicated across 12+ studies since 2018, effect size small to moderate | Real. Expect a modest reduction in self-reported stress and slightly better sleep onset, especially in people who already liked plants. Not a treatment for insomnia. |
| NASA Clean Air Study shows plants remove VOCs and purify the air | Strong in lab conditions, weak when extrapolated to real rooms | Technically true; functionally misleading. The NASA study used a sealed chamber with about 700 plants per square meter — that density is not what a reader’s bedroom looks like. To meaningfully filter VOCs from a real bedroom, the reader would need roughly 700 plants, not one on the nightstand. |
| Plants release oxygen at night (CAM photosynthesis) | True for a subset of species (Snake plant, ZZ plant, Aloe, Orchid, Bromeliad); effect on bedroom O2 levels is unmeasurable | The biology is correct — CAM plants do open their stomata at night. But a single Snake plant shifts the bedroom O2 concentration by parts per billion, which is below what a person can detect or benefit from. The framing of “oxygen at night” is honest botany dressed up as a sleep aid. |
| Some bedroom plants are toxic if pets chew them | Strong — ASPCA database is the reference | The trade-off disclosure that matters most: several popular low-light species (Pothos, Philodendron, Peace Lily, Snake plant mildly, Lily family severely for cats) are toxic if chewed. If a pet sleeps in the bedroom, use the cluster’s pet-safe picks instead. |
The honest takeaway: a low-light houseplant in the bedroom likely makes a small but real difference for mood and stress, will not meaningfully change the air chemistry, and may be a hazard if the reader has a pet that chews plants. Set the expectation at “calmer room, slightly better sleep onset” rather than “air purifier,” and the plant earns its slot honestly. Bedroom Light: How to Read What You Actually Have
Bedrooms are usually read as darker than they actually are at the brightest moment of the day, because curtains are typically drawn during the day and windows are smaller than living-room windows. A quick three-step assessment separates “this room can take a Snake plant or ZZ plant” from “this room is too dark for any species without grow lights.”
- At the brightest time for the bedroom (typically 11 a.m. to 1 p.m. for north-facing, 9 a.m. to 10 a.m. for east-facing, 3 p.m. to 4 p.m. for west-facing), open the curtains fully. Note the brightest spot — usually a windowsill or the floor patch about 3 feet from the window.
- Do the shadow test from the cluster’s hub page: hold a hand 12 inches from a white wall at that brightest spot. A soft-edged shadow that you can tell is a hand but not crisp = medium light (250 to 1,000 foot-candles). A barely visible shadow = low light (50 to 250 foot-candles). No visible shadow = very low light, which most houseplants cannot survive indefinitely. The mechanism behind leggy growth covers what happens when a plant is below its compensation point.
- Repeat at two more times in one day — for example, 9 a.m. and 4 p.m. for a north-facing room. Use the brightest reading. A bedroom with drawn curtains that blocks the brightest noon reading is a different light environment from one with open curtains during the day, and the species that survive differ.
Predicted guidance based on the assessment: if the bedroom’s brightest spot reads low light (most north-facing bedrooms), the picks list below is the right set of candidates. If the brightest spot reads medium light (south-facing bedroom with sheer curtains, east-facing bedroom where morning sun lands on a windowsill), the picks list is overkill — most of the species below will grow faster than expected, and the bedroom will start to feel overplanted within a year. If the brightest spot reads very low light (interior bedroom with a frosted window or no direct window access), a single Snake plant or ZZ plant will survive but grow very slowly, and most other species will fail within six months.
The 8 Best Low-Light Bedroom Plants, Ranked
Eight low light houseplants earn the slot in a bedroom — ranked below against the bedroom-specific criteria, not generic shade tolerance. Each entry covers light range, watering frequency in low light, humidity tolerance, mature size, toxicity to cats and dogs, and the bedroom-specific failure mode to watch for. The species that almost make the list but fail one filter are named in the “near misses” section after the table.
| Rank | Species | Light range (foot-candles) | Watering in low light | Humidity tolerance | Mature size | Pet-safe (ASPCA)? |
|---|---|---|---|---|---|---|
| 1 | Snake plant (Dracaena trifasciata / Sansevieria trifasciata) | 25 to 500+ | Every 14 to 21 days | 25 to 60% | 12 to 48 inches | No — mildly toxic |
| 2 | ZZ plant (Zamioculcas zamiifolia) | 30 to 500+ | Every 14 to 21 days | 20 to 60% | 24 to 36 inches | No — mildly toxic |
| 3 | Pothos (Epipremnum aureum) | 50 to 500+ | Every 10 to 14 days | 40 to 60% | Trailing, 36 to 72 inches | No — toxic |
| 4 | Cast iron plant (Aspidistra elatior) | 25 to 250 | Every 14 to 21 days | 25 to 60% | 24 to 36 inches | No — mildly toxic |
| 5 | Peace lily (Spathiphyllum wallisii) | 50 to 500+ | Every 7 to 10 days (wilts when thirsty) | 40 to 60% | 24 to 36 inches | No — toxic |
| 6 | Philodendron heartleaf (Philodendron hederaceum) | 75 to 500+ | Every 10 to 14 days | 40 to 60% | Trailing, 24 to 60 inches | No — toxic |
| 7 | Chinese evergreen (Aglaonema commutatum) | 50 to 500+ | Every 10 to 14 days | 40 to 60% | 18 to 36 inches | No — toxic |
| 8 | Mass cane (Dracaena fragrans) | 75 to 500+ | Every 10 to 14 days | 30 to 60% | 36 to 96 inches (floor plant) | No — toxic |
Three observations from the table matter more than the rankings themselves.
No species in the top eight is pet-safe at ASPCA “non-toxic” level. Every Snake plant, ZZ plant, Pothos, Cast iron, Peace lily, Philodendron, Chinese evergreen, and Mass cane entry is mildly to severely toxic to cats and dogs if chewed. Within 24 hours of chewing, pets can show oral irritation (calcium oxalate-containing species), vomiting (saponin-containing species), or in the case of Lily family exposure in cats, acute kidney failure. If a pet sleeps in the bedroom, the reader should switch to the low light pet safe plants list — Parlor Palm, Spider plant, Boston Fern, Calathea (with caveats), African Violet, and Prayer plant are the substitutions that clear the toxicity filter. This is the single most important takeaway for pet households reading this page.
The Snake plant is the top pick because its failure mode is the gentlest. In low light (50 to 100 foot-candles), Snake plant pushes 1 to 2 new leaves per year versus 4 to 6 in bright indirect, and tolerates 14 to 21 days between waterings in winter. The substrate stays wet long enough that overwatering is the main risk, but the rhizome stores water in a way that recovers from one-off overwatering episodes that would rot Pothos or Peace lily. The mature size range (12 to 48 inches, depending on cultivar) covers nightstand, dresser, and small-floor placements. The trade-off is mild toxicity — not as severe as Peace lily (which causes oral pain on contact) but not pet-safe.
Peace lily and Philodendron are honest “I want flowers / trailing form” picks, not “low light pet-safe” picks. Peace lily signals its water needs by wilting dramatically — the helpful-leaf-drop trait — then recovers within hours after watering. The fail mode is that the dramatic wilt scares owners into overwatering, which rots the roots. Philodendron heartleaf is the trailing pick for shelves and hanging baskets; it tolerates being trimmed back hard and pushes new growth from the cut nodes within weeks. Neither clears the pet-safe filter.
Near-misses that almost made the list: Calathea (drops leaves in dry winter bedrooms, fails the humidity filter); Boston Fern (needs 50%+ humidity, fails the same way); Spider plant (passes every filter except low-light ceiling — does best at 100+ foot-candles, marginal in very low bedrooms); English Ivy (high humidity needs, plus invasive if it ever goes outside); Fiddle-leaf Fig (looks low-light-tolerant, is not — drops leaves below 200 foot-candles). The trade-off disclosure that is worth printing: Calathea’s failure mode in dry bedrooms is severe and fast — leaves crisp within three weeks. If the bedroom humidity is below 40% in winter, do not buy Calathea expecting it to work.
Where to Place Bedroom Plants (And Where Not To)
Placement in the bedroom is a safety question first and an aesthetic question second. A bedroom plant on the floor near the bed is a trip hazard at 2 a.m. — failing to account for that is a more common cause of plant death than any care mistake. Use this placement rule by size class.
- Nightstand plants (under 14 inches mature height): pick species with stable, low centers of gravity. Snake plant cultivars “Moonshine” and “Hahnii” stay under 12 inches and have broad-based rosettes that do not tip. Avoid tall narrow cultivars on standard nightstands — the failure mode is a bent stem when the reader reaches past the plant for a phone at night.
- Dresser plants (14 to 28 inches): Pothos trailing off the edge of a dresser, ZZ plant in a heavy ceramic pot, Mass cane in a 10-inch nursery pot — these clear the nightstand trip-hazard zone and add visual weight. Anchor tall pots with a small sand layer in the cachepot to lower the center of gravity.
- Floor plants (over 28 inches): only on stands wider than the pot, in rooms where the path between bed and door does not run through the plant zone. Mass cane, large Snake plant cultivars, and large Cast iron plants work — predict that floor plants near HVAC vents dry out twice as fast as corner placements, so plan to water on the shorter end of the species’ range (every 10 to 14 days versus 14 to 21).

When a Bedroom Plant Starts Struggling — Quick Triage
If the bedroom plant is yellowing, drooping, or dropping leaves, run the four-question diagnostic before changing the watering routine. The cluster has a dedicated page for this at low-light yellow leaves; the short triage here is the version to use in the moment.
- How many leaves are affected? One leaf or one stem = natural shedding, no fix needed. Multiple leaves within a few days = real problem.
- Stick a finger 1 inch into the soil. Is it wet below the surface? Wet soil + yellow leaves = overwatering (the most common cause in low light — let the top 2 inches dry before watering again). Dry soil + yellow leaves = either underwatering (rare in low light) or nutrient deficiency (more common; see below).
- When did you last fertilize? Over 6 months ago = likely nutrient deficiency (low-light plants grow slowly so they need less, but they still need some — half-strength balanced fertilizer once or twice during spring and summer growing season). Under 1 month ago = could be fertilizer burn; flush the soil with plain water and skip the next feeding.
- Are the leaves yellow all over or in patches? All over = watering or nutrient issue. In patches, or with brown spots or webbing on the underside = check for spider mites (different page). Mushy stem at the soil line = root rot, immediate repot required.
Predictive guidance for the next four to six weeks: a Snake plant whose watering routine is corrected after overwatering typically pushes a new leaf within six to eight weeks. A Peace lily that has been overwatered for a month typically takes two to three months to recover. A Mass cane that lost lower leaves from under-watering usually refills those nodes within one growing season if watering stabilizes. The honest limitation: yellow leaves do not turn green again; the plant grows new ones to replace them. A snake plant that lost three outer leaves will push three new ones in time, not regreen the lost leaves.
